代码大全-21章协同构建
2018-01-24 09:44
423 查看
每天一语: 群处守嘴,独处守心。修己以清心为要,涉世以慎言为先!
21章协同构建
20.1协同开发实践概要
协同构建的首要目的就是改善软件的质量,其实协同开发就是两个或者以上的开发者共同开发一个功能,其目的可以共同编码格式及功能代码全员化。
20.2结对编程
结对编程的意思就是两个的开发者共同开发同一个软件或者程序。其作用是两个人可以互助,共同发现代码中的问题以及养成统一的编程习惯,更为重要的是可以降低功能的维护性,如果其中一个开发者离职了 ,其它人可以快速的补上去。
21.3 正式检查
这个小节讲解了正式检查的作用及步骤,其实说白了有就是类似于编码完成之后的代码的CR,开发者拉几个程序员去开个小会议,然后在会议上过代码,参与者们查看编码风格结构及逻辑,然后给出缺陷,然后由开发者进行修改缺陷的过程。
21.4其他类型的协同开发实践
这个小节讲解了其他的没有足够的实践经验作为支持的协作方法,如走查法、代码阅读、公开演示的方法,这些方法适用性不强
总结:总的来说协同构建开发两个或者以上的开发者共同开发一个功能,其目的可以共同编码格式及功能代码全员化。
21章协同构建
20.1协同开发实践概要
协同构建的首要目的就是改善软件的质量,其实协同开发就是两个或者以上的开发者共同开发一个功能,其目的可以共同编码格式及功能代码全员化。
20.2结对编程
结对编程的意思就是两个的开发者共同开发同一个软件或者程序。其作用是两个人可以互助,共同发现代码中的问题以及养成统一的编程习惯,更为重要的是可以降低功能的维护性,如果其中一个开发者离职了 ,其它人可以快速的补上去。
21.3 正式检查
这个小节讲解了正式检查的作用及步骤,其实说白了有就是类似于编码完成之后的代码的CR,开发者拉几个程序员去开个小会议,然后在会议上过代码,参与者们查看编码风格结构及逻辑,然后给出缺陷,然后由开发者进行修改缺陷的过程。
21.4其他类型的协同开发实践
这个小节讲解了其他的没有足够的实践经验作为支持的协作方法,如走查法、代码阅读、公开演示的方法,这些方法适用性不强
总结:总的来说协同构建开发两个或者以上的开发者共同开发一个功能,其目的可以共同编码格式及功能代码全员化。
相关文章推荐
- 【代码大全】第21章 协同构建
- 【代码大全】第5章 软件构建中的设计
- 第四章关键的构建决策(代码大全2)
- 代码大全(五)-- 软件构建中的设计
- 代码大全学习-30-构建管理(Managing Construction)
- 代码大全2-软件构建中的设计
- 代码大全--软件构建中的设计
- 代码大全第二版读书笔记 第二部分-创建高质量的代码 五、软件构建中的设计
- CODE COMPLETE NOTES 代码大全笔记 (SOFTWARE CONSTRUCTION)软件构建
- [读书笔记-代码大全]第1章 欢迎进入软件构建的世界
- 代码大全2笔记-欢迎进入软件构建的世界
- 代码大全2笔记-第一章-软件构建
- 读书笔记_代码大全_第4章_关键的“构建”决策
- 代码大全2-软件构建中的设计
- 【代码大全】第1章 欢迎进入软件构建的世界
- 【读书笔记】代码大全21章:团队编程
- 读书笔记-代码大全-第一章软件构建
- 第1章欢迎进入软件构建的世界(代码大全6)
- 代码大全2笔记-第四章-“构建”前的决策
- 【代码大全】第4章 关键的“构建“决策